Key Product Features & Technical Advantages:
- Integrated Bypass System: A standout feature that allows for pressure equalization and safe isolation of mainline sections. This facilitates easier operation of the main valve under high differential pressure and enables safe maintenance procedures without requiring a full system shutdown.
- Robust Pressure Handling: Rated for PN1.6 to PN6.4MPa (equivalent to Class 150 to 400), this valve is built to withstand the rigorous pressure demands of marine engine rooms, ballast systems, fuel lines, and cargo handling systems.
- Superior Sealing Performance: Features a precision-machined wedge disc and seat arrangement, typically metal-to-metal, ensuring bubble-tight shut-off even after prolonged cycles, which is critical for preventing leaks in sensitive marine environments.
- Corrosion-Resistant Construction: Available in a range of materials including cast steel, stainless steel (CF8/CF8M), and bronze, selected for their excellent resistance to seawater, saline atmospheres, and various marine fluids.
- Multiple Operation Options: Designed for flexibility, the valve can be supplied with a standard handwheel, manual gear operator for high-torque applications, or automated with electric, pneumatic, or hydraulic actuators for remote control integration.
- Compliant Design: Manufactured in accordance with international marine and industrial standards such as ISO, DIN, JIS, and ANSI/ASME, ensuring compatibility and acceptance in global shipbuilding and repair yards.
Technical Specifications & Configuration Options:
| Parameter | Specification / Option |
| Pressure Rating | PN1.6, PN2.5, PN4.0, PN6.4 MPa |
| Size Range (Nominal Diameter) | DN15 to DN600 (1/2" to 24") |
| Body & Bonnet Material | WCB, WCC, CF8, CF8M, C95800 |
| Seat & Disc Material | 13%Cr/13%Cr, Stellite, 316 SS |
| Stem Material | 13%Cr, 17-4PH, 316 SS, Monel |
| Connection Standard | ISO, DIN, JIS, ANSI Flanges; NPT Threads |
| Temperature Range | -20°C to +425°C (material dependent) |
| Bypass Valve Size | Typically DN15 or DN20, integrated |

Q: What is the primary purpose of the integrated bypass on this marine gate valve?
A: The integrated bypass serves multiple critical functions. Primarily, it allows for pressure equalization across the main valve disc before opening, reducing the required operating torque and preventing potential damage. It also provides a controlled flow path for system draining, venting, or sampling, and enables safe isolation for maintenance without depressurizing the entire line. -

Q: Is the bypass valve included as standard, and is it also a gate valve?
A: The integrated bypass is a standard feature of this product line. The bypass is typically a smaller, globe or needle-type valve designed for fine flow control during equalization, draining, or venting operations, offering more precise regulation than a gate valve would for this auxiliary function. -

Q: How does the gear operator benefit the valve's function?
A: A manual gear operator provides a significant mechanical advantage, making it possible to open and close large-diameter or high-pressure class valves with relative ease. This is especially useful in applications where high stem torque is required or where space constraints make a large handwheel impractical. -
